Functional preoperative and intraoperative mapping and monitoring: increasing safety and efficacy in glioma surgery

Abstract: Greater extent of resection (EOR) of low-grade gliomas is associated with improved survival. Proximity to eloquent cortical regions often limits resectability and elevates the risk of surgery-related deficits. Therefore, functional localization of eloquent cortex or subcortical fiber tracts can enhance the EOR and functional outcome.
